Court dismisses gas flaring suit against ExxonMobil
The Federal High Court sitting in Lagos, on Friday, 22 November 2024, dismissed two suits filed by the Incorporated Trustees of Aibom Oil Producing Community Development Network (AIBOM) against Mobil Producing Nigeria Unlimited (ExxonMobil). From the Court papers, in the two cases respectively marked as Suit No. FHC/L/CS/276/23 and Suit No. FHC/L/CS/278/23, AIBOM had through its lawyer, D.A.
